What is low code development?

Low code development is a software development approach that allows developers to create applications with minimal coding. It typically involves a visual interface, drag-and-drop functionality, and pre-built templates or components that can be easily customized and configured. This approach enables developers to build applications faster and with less complexity compared to traditional coding methods.

With low code development, developers can focus more on the logic and functionality of the application rather than writing lines of code. This results in increased productivity and efficiency, as well as a quicker time to market for software solutions.

Some key features of low code development platforms include:

  • Visual interface: Allows developers to design and build applications using visual elements such as drag-and-drop widgets and components.
  • Rapid prototyping: Enables quick iteration and testing of application ideas and concepts.
  • Integration capabilities: Provides seamless integration with existing systems and databases.
  • Collaboration tools: Supports teamwork and collaboration among developers and stakeholders.
  • Scalability: Allows applications to easily scale and grow as business needs evolve.

Features and capabilities of OutSystems for UI development

OutSystems is a leading low code UI development platform that offers a wide range of features and capabilities. Some of the key features include:

  1. Visual Development Environment: OutSystems provides a visual development environment that allows users to drag and drop components, creating UIs without the need for extensive coding. This makes it easy for both developers and non-technical users to design and build user interfaces.
  2. Mobile App Development: OutSystems offers built-in support for mobile app development, allowing users to create responsive and engaging mobile interfaces. It provides native integration with mobile device features such as camera, GPS, and contacts, enabling the development of feature-rich mobile applications.
  3. Reusable UI Components: OutSystems comes with a library of reusable UI components, including buttons, forms, tables, and charts. These components can be easily customized and integrated into applications, saving development time and effort.
  4. Integration: OutSystems provides seamless integration with third-party systems and databases. It offers connectors to popular services such as Salesforce, SAP, and Microsoft Dynamics, enabling users to incorporate data and functionality from external sources.
  5. Collaboration and Version Control: OutSystems provides built-in collaboration features, allowing multiple developers to work on the same project simultaneously. It also offers version control capabilities, enabling users to easily track changes, roll back to previous versions, and collaborate effectively.
  6. Security: OutSystems prioritizes security and compliance. It offers robust authentication and access control mechanisms, ensuring that applications built with the platform are secure and compliant with industry standards.
  7. Scalability: OutSystems is built to handle enterprise-level applications and can scale to accommodate high volumes of users and data.

Integration options and ease of use

When it comes to integration options and ease of use, OutSystems, Mendix, and Salesforce Lightning Platform are all strong contenders in the low code UI development space.

OutSystems offers a seamless and intuitive integration experience. It provides a wide range of connectors and APIs to integrate with other systems and databases, making it easy to incorporate data and functionality from external sources. Additionally, OutSystems has a visual development interface with drag-and-drop capabilities, allowing users with limited coding experience to easily design and build UI components.

Mendix also offers robust integration capabilities, including pre-built connectors, RESTful APIs, and a data hub for managing data and integrating with external systems. The platform prioritizes ease of use, with a user-friendly development environment that supports visual modeling and collaboration. Mendix’s App Store further enhances the ease of use by providing a marketplace of pre-built components and templates that can be easily integrated into UI development projects.

Salesforce Lightning Platform is known for its seamless integration with other Salesforce products, such as Sales Cloud and Service Cloud. It offers a range of integration capabilities, including APIs, web services, and AppExchange, allowing for easy integration with external systems and data sources. Salesforce’s low code development environment, also known as Salesforce App Builder, provides a drag-and-drop interface for building UI components and customizing layouts.
